问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501
你好,欢迎来到懂视!登录注册
当前位置: 首页 - 正文

excel排名咋弄

发布网友 发布时间:2022-02-20 03:57

我来回答

2个回答

热心网友 时间:2022-02-20 08:18

excel排名的设置方法:

产品型号:Dell 灵越5000

系统版本:Windows 10

软件版本:Microsoft Office Excel 2020

首先,打开Excel表格,输入你需要的数据,然后选中一个名次的单元格,

在单元格输入公式,=RANK(H2,H&2:H$8,0) 按回车键即可,

然后点击单元格下拉就完成了。


总结:

1.输入好数据

2.输入排名次的公式

3.回车下拉单元格


热心网友 时间:2022-02-20 05:26

如何根据当前数据统计对应的排名,这是实际中经常遇到的需求。本文介绍Excel中排名统计的基本需求,以及分组排名、*度权重综合排名等复杂排名需求的实现方法。


以下根据学员分数排名,名次显示在C列:

名次统计公式如下:

C2单元格公式如下:

=RANK(B2,$B$2:$B$13,0)

拖动C2公式拓展到C13单元格完成名次统计公式输入。


RANK函数语法:

函数语法:

RANK(number,ref,[order]) 

函数作用:

获得数据对应的排名

参数说明:

number:需要统计排名次的数字;

ref:数字数组或数字单元格区域引用,其中非数值型参数将被忽略;

order:排位方式,0或忽略按降序排列(即常规说的正数排名),非0按升序排列(即常规说的倒数排名);


可用以下方法实现类似Rank的排名统计:

=COUNTIF($B$2:$B$13,">="&B2)

=SUMPRODUCT(($B$2:$B$13>=B2)*1)


需要特别注意的是,RANK函数排名有个问题,虽然对重复数字排名相同,但重复数对后续数字排名有影响。譬如:如下两个54分,并列排名第八,53分排名第十,却跳过了第九,这不符合中国式排名要求。


按照中国式排名要求,解决方案:

C2单元格公式改进如下:

=SUMPRODUCT(($B$2:$B$13>=B2)/COUNTIF($B$2:$B$13,$B$2:$B$13))

公式解释:

($B$2:$B$13>=B2)

统计大于等于当前分数的个数,包含重复数

/COUNTIF($B$2:$B$13,$B$2:$B$13)

除以与当前分数相同的个数,确保相同分数并列排名,且只统计一次

SUMPRODUCT

把符合上述条件的个数求和


公式改进后效果如下:


复杂排名需求应用示例:

按照上述改进思路,可以满足复杂的排名场景要求,示例如下:


【1】分组或分类排名

在上述数据基础上增加班级列,按班级排名如下:

D2单元格公式如下:

=SUMPRODUCT(($A$2:$A$13=A2)*($C$2:$C$13>=C2)/COUNTIFS($A$2:$A$13,$A$2:$A$13,$C$2:$C$13,$C$2:$C$13))

公式解释:

($A$2:$A$13=A2)*($C$2:$C$13>=C2)

统计本班级大于等于当前分数的个数,包含重复数

/COUNTIFS($A$2:$A$13,$A$2:$A$13,$C$2:$C$13,$C$2:$C$13)

除以本班级与当前分数相同的个数,确保相同分数并列排名,且只统计一次

SUMPRODUCT

把符合上述条件的个数求和


【2】*度综合权重排名

按语文、数学、英语三科权重:40%、40%、20%综合排名

E2单元格公式如下:

=SUMPRODUCT(N(($B$2:$B$13*40%+$C$2:$C$13*40%+$D$2:$D$13*20%)>=(B2*40%+C2*40%+D2*20%)))

N函数作用:把比较结果TRUE返回1,FALSE返回0


N函数介绍:

语法:N(value)

用途:转化为数值返回。可以转化的值:数字返回该数字,日期返回该日期的序列号,TRUE返回1,FALSE返回0,错误值(如#DIV/0!)返回该错误值,其他值返回0。

参数:value为要转化的值。  


根据名次显示排名示例:

要求E\F\G按名次先后排列,显示如下:


列公式:

E2输入以下数组公式,按<Ctrl+Shift+Enter>,将公式填充至E2:F13区域

{=INDEX($A:$A,MOD(LARGE($B$2:$B$13*100+ROW($B$2:$B$13),ROW(A1)),100))}


F列公式:

{=INDEX($B:$B,MOD(LARGE($B$2:$B$13*100+ROW($B$2:$B$13),ROW(A1)),100))}

G列公式:

{=INDEX($C:$C,MOD(LARGE($B$2:$B$13*100+ROW($B$2:$B$13),ROW(A1)),100))}


公式解释:

$B$2:$B$13*100

分数乘以100,确保不影响分数排序

$B$2:$B$13*100+ROW($B$2:$B$13)

加上当前行号,方便取得排名对应的行号

MOD(LARGE($B$2:$B$13*100+ROW($B$2:$B$13),ROW(A1)),100)

MOD函数去掉上面乘的100,获取排名对应的行号


INDEX($A:$A, 排名对应的行号)

获取对应的姓名

INDEX($B:$B, 排名对应的行号)

获取对应的分数

INDEX($C:$C, 排名对应的行号)

获取对应的名次

如何在EXCEL表格里按照名次从高到低排序?

1. 打开你的Excel表格,在需要排序的单元格中,例如A列的第一个单元格,输入数字“1”。2. 将鼠标放在该已输入数字的单元格的右下角,你会发现鼠标变成了一个十字形状。3. 按住鼠标左键,同时拖动鼠标向下移动,你会发现下方的单元格自动填充了递增的数字。这样,简单的名次排序就完成了。

excel怎么按排名?

:excel排名次且不改变原顺序,具体操作如下:1、打开要排名的表格,如图所示,点击C2单元格。2、点击公式,点击插入函数。3、在弹出的界面中,搜索并选择rank,点击确定。4、在打开的函数参数界面中,点击Number选项框,选择B2单元格。5、点击Ref选项框,选择B2到B7单元格,点击f4键,使用绝对引用。6、...

excel怎么排序并显示排名

1、打开excel表格。2、点击F2单元格,点击公式,再点击插入函数。3、在搜索函数中输入rank,点击转到选项。4、在选择函数中选择rank,点击确定。5、点击Number窗口后面的按钮,选择E2单元格。6、点击Ref窗口后面的按钮,选择E2到E8单元格,并在中间加入$符号,参考下图。 7、Order窗口中输入0即可。8、点...

excel准确的排名公式怎么弄

:excel准确的排名公式为=RANK(XX,XX,XX)。具体操作步骤如下:1、打开excel表格,在要计算排名的单元格上点击,并在编辑栏中输入公式:=RANK(E2,$E$2:$E$6,0)。2、按下回车键,即可得到名次。3、选中F2单元格,并将鼠标放到单元格的右下角位置,当鼠标变成十字形,向下拖动,即可得到所有的...

怎么用excel给成绩排名

使用WPSoffice11.1.0操作。首先我们选中需要处理的这两列数据,点击上方工具栏中的【数据】,选择排序;在弹出来的选项卡中,选择【主要关键字】为列C,也就是成绩所在的这一列排序依据选择数值;也就是成绩的大小,次序选择降序,点击确定,即可看到学生成绩按照从大到小依次进行了排列。

EXCEL中如何给成绩进行排名

EXCEL中如何给成绩进行排名呢?下面小编来教大家。1、首先,我们打开一张成绩表的excel文档;2、然后我们选中成绩的区域,之后我们点击数据;3、然后我们点击降序;4、弹出的界面,我们点击排序;5、最终结果如图所示,这样我们就将排名做好了,从高到低进行了排名,而姓名是会自动进行排序的。

在excel中怎样对数据进行排名?

1、在使用excel表格中的排序命令的时候,会发现排序之后越来越乱,这里分享下解决方法1首先打开excel 表格,将数据按照地区进行排序2全部选中之后,点击排序和筛选按钮3点击下拉菜单中的升序选项4点击之后会发现排。2、EXCEL排序为何总是出错, 原因可能是由于单元格设置的格式差异所造成的下面就excel中排序...

在EXCEL中,怎样排名次?

在 Excel 中,单元格大小不一致可能导致排名不准确,因为单元格大小影响了单元格中的数据显示,从而影响了计算结果。在此情况下推荐使用以下步骤进行排名:1. 先将数据复制到一个单元格大小一致的新表格中。2. 在新表格中选中要排名的数据范围,然后单击“数据”选项卡上的“排序”按钮。3. 在“排序”...

excel怎么给成绩排名

在Excel中,给成绩进行排名相当直观。以联想拯救者Y7000这款搭载Windows 10系统的电脑为例,其预装了WPS 2019。以下是具体步骤:首先,打开你的成绩单,确保数据准备就绪。在顶部菜单栏中,找到并点击"数据"选项。在下拉菜单中,选择"排序"功能。在弹出的对话框中,将列C(通常包含成绩的那列)设为主要...

excel怎么弄名次,excel怎么编排名次

1、首先我们输入需要统计的数据,然后选中统计名次的单元格,并且点击 公式 选项 2、然后点击 常用函数 ,再点击插入函数 3、然后在搜索框输入RANK,选择RANK后 点击确定,然后在第一个输入框中输入需要统计名次的单元格位置(比如H2),在第二个输入框中输入全部数据的位置(比如H2:H11,为绝对引用的意思...

声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。
E-MAIL:11247931@qq.com
怎么修改淘宝上买家的退货地址? 如何修改默认退货地址?? 如何在解压全能王中智能解压加密压缩包? 怎么解压缩包密码啊? 压缩包密码如何解压 2023年六大免费开源PDF编辑器(适用于桌面端和在线) 有哪些编辑markdown的编辑器? 在线编辑器哪个好 如何使用SaveEditorOnline? 新车未过磨合期跑长途有危害吗? Microsoft Office Excel 怎么弄成绩排名? Excel表格如何排名次 excel怎么进行排名 excel名次排名怎么弄 excel排名怎么做 excel怎么查找自己想要的内容 如何搜索excel很多行的内容 Excel怎么快速找到我想要的内容 excel表格中如何查找内容 excel怎么同时查找多个内容 Excel查找全部,怎么把查找出来内容全部复制? 要在很多Excel表格中查找指定的内容,怎么操作啊~ EXCEL查找功能的问题:如何查找单元格内部分内容? excel怎么查找自己想要的内容? excel如何查找文字,问题如下? 在EXCEL中如何查找匹配的内容。 excel怎样查找内容 在excel里面怎么查找内容 excel中如何查找多个内容 excel怎么查找内容快捷键 excel如何将数据排名 excel怎么弄排名 用excel怎么排名次 excel表格怎么弄排名 在excel中如何排名次 excel排名怎么用 在excel中名次怎么弄 excel表格怎么排名 EXCEL表格怎么弄名次 请教一下excel表格怎么排名 Excel中如何弄排名? excel中怎么设置最合适的列宽 Excel中,怎样设置列宽 在excel表格中怎样调列宽 excel表怎么设置行宽列宽 怎么设置整个excel 的行高和列宽 excel表格如何调整列宽 excel固定列宽怎么设置 怎么调整excel列宽 怎么在excel中设置整个表格的列宽? 谢谢各位了!
  • 焦点

最新推荐

猜你喜欢

热门推荐